Mohanlal’s been doing at least one project every month since the lockdown rules were eased and his latest titled Monster, which is directed by Vysakh and Udaykrishna, promises to be an exciting action-entertainer.

The superstar revealed the poster of the movie that introduced his character Lucky Singh. The actor wears a turban in the poster and holds a gun with a few cartridges, guns and a silencer lying on the table. The team has not let out the one-liner of the film or the rest of the cast yet.

Monster is the second time Mohanlal is teaming up with Vysakh after their blockbuster film Pulimurugan, which was also scripted by Udaykrishna. The movie, which has gone on floors in Kochi, has Deepak Dev as its composer while Satheesh Kurup and Shameer Mohammed will serve as the cinematographer and editor respectively.

The past week, the movie’s producer Antony Perumbavoor had confirmed that Monster will also be an OTT release, much like Mohanlal’s upcoming films – Priyadarshan’s Marakkar: Arabikadalinte Simham, Prithviraj Sukumaran’s Bro Daddy, Jeethu Joseph’s 12th Man and Shaji Kailas’ Alone.

While Marakkar and Bro Daddy have reportedly been sold to Amazon Prime Video and Disney+ Hotstar respectively, the streaming platforms for 12th Man, Alone and Monster are yet to be finalised. Considering that the makers had planned the movie as OTT releases, it remains to be seen whether Monster will be a big-budget film like Pulimurugan.

Mohanlal’s next theatrical release, meanwhile, will be B Unnikrishnan’s Aaraattu that is also scripted by Udaykrishna. The team had announced that the film will hit theatres in Kerala on February 10, 2022.
